saw this post on Gaming on Linux about the Carbon engine go open sourced on GitHub, used in their games EVE Online and EVE frontier.

Fenris Creations (Formerly known as CCP Games) made the announcement a while back, my guess this is something to do with the Google team up for AI and then going independent again.

it’s good for open source but the engine like Dagor is in Parts and probably not worth looking at it now until they release the template or how to use it, this would probably interest game engines developers but not general developers wanting to make games, as there is no editor.

I would not recommend to make games with this unless you really like game engine tech or have a dedicated developer making game engines.

Now the thing is Fenris is probably going to show a template in the future hopefully, how to build a game using these tech I doubt it can replace The big engines like Unity or Unreal or Godot.

Based on the games industry article it feels like Fenris Creations hopes to get users to contribute to the game via the engine looking for bugs and security issues, they also got advice from Godot and how to run some of these open source projects, Still it’s a neat project to be part of for open source.
